Default What Bolt size for 6Cyl swap DS?

Hi all - need a little help on an odd question. Doing an auto to manual swap on an E36 325is. Using a 4cyl 318Ti manual driveshaft. I removed the front vibration damper (not guibo/flex disc) in order to clear shift rod, etc. I also removed the studs and planed to use bolts like other E36s.

Got the DS in the 325is and found out M12 bolts do not fit the 3 bolt flange on the driveshaft. It appears they are M10 bolts. That will not work as the guibo/flex disc is 6 x M12.

I cross referenced part numbers on real OEM while also looking at old threads, haven't seen anyone with this issue.
